About the role

The Maintenance Clerk is responsible for the organization and maintenance of the parts room and the tool crib. This position assists the maintenance mechanics and technicians by providing them with the tools and parts necessary to complete their projects. The coordinator will also be held responsible for maintaining inventory by ordering and stocking parts as necessary.

Duties and Responsibilities: 

  • Maintain and organize the maintenance parts area and the tool crib. 

  • Order requested items and log entries in the allocated software programs. 

  • Release or issue parts from inventory system. 

  • Stock inbound parts in allocated bins or shelves.   

  • Take daily or weekly cycle counts of the inventory items in the maintenance parts area. 

  • Assist all maintenance and engineering personnel locate and record all parts used. 

  • Retrieve requested parts from suppliers with company vehicle. 

  • Communicate with the parts room supervisor at all times. 

  • Evaluate and make recommendations / suggestions to make the parts room a more efficient operation. 

  • Maintain daily logs, produce and distribute maintenance reports as required. 

  • Prepare packages for out bound shipping, including labeling. 

  • Communicates daily with outside vendors to make sure all parts are ordered and delivered within expected time. 

  • Works with Planner/Scheduler to make sure all parts are ready and staged for all scheduled work orders. 

  • Ensure all purchase orders (POs) provided to vendors are documented and tracked to budget. 

  • Assume additional duties as directed by supervisors and members of management. 

  • Flexibility to work overtime and non-standard hours as needed, including evenings, weekends, and holidays. 

  • Perform all other duties as assigned. 

 

Minimum Job Requirements: 

 

Education/Certifications and Experience: 

  • High school diploma or GED. 

  • Previous experience working in food manufacturing or a similar production environment, preferred. 

  • Some clerical background including: filing, typing, 10 key and data tracking.  

 

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ities: 

  • Proficient use of a computer,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, OneNote), and other related applications or software. 

  • Must be able to drive a forklift and successfully complete the Company’s mobile powered equipment training.  

  • A positive work attitude.  

  • Ability to produce and understand reports including but not limited to debits and credits.  

  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ment.
